🪰 Hatch Calendar
Tellico River · June · Early Summer

Yellow Sally (size 14-16) and Light Cahill (size 14-16). Sulphurs continuing. Caddis (size 14-16) evenings. Tight-quarters dry fly fishing in classic Appalachian style.

About Tellico River
The Tellico River in the Cherokee National Forest near Tellico Plains is a classic Southern Appalachian freestone stream — clear, cold, and loaded with wild rainbow trout. A beloved destination for Cherokee NF anglers with easy access, beautiful scenery, and the kind of tight-quarters dry fly fishing that Appalachian streams are known for.
Regulations
Cherokee National Forest. Multiple regulation sections: Catch-and-Release/Artificial Only and Delayed Harvest sections in addition to stocked water. Check TWRA for current zone boundaries before fishing.
